Rather than asking ‘how did I come to this belief’ (which may be irrelevant —
we can accidentally stumble upon truths without valid justification, and we
can easily have reasonable-sounding justifications for false or unreliable
ideas), you might be better of asking ‘under what circumstances does this not
hold?’ This is called abductive reasoning, & is the basis of the scientific
method.
